### Step 4: Enable the circuit breaker

Plugins calling the Westhollow upstream API must now route through the Brassgate breaker. Direct calls will be rejected after version 3.0. Register your plugin's client handle, then set failure thresholds conservatively — tripping too early starves retries. Once registered, update your manifest to match the breaker's configuration values shown below.

config for bagep-kageg:
ULADOR_LOG_LEVEL=warn
ULADOR_METRICS_HOST=metrics.ulador.tolvaqcorp.corp
ULADOR_POOL_SIZE=32

Hey, welcome to on-call for Ledgerline! Quick context: the events table is partitioned by month, and a cron job creates next month's partition on the 25th. When that job fails (it happens), inserts start erroring right at midnight on the 1st — fun times. The runbook has the manual `CREATE PARTITION` steps. To run them, you'll connect to the primary with the connection string below.

database URL for hafog-yahip: clickhouse://rusir_svc:LpcRMav@db-3230.norvaforge.example:5432/gorir

## Onboarding: The Parcelhop Webhook

Welcome aboard! Parcelhop pings our endpoint every time a package changes status — picked up, in transit, delivered, or mysteriously "delayed." We verify every payload, because spoofed delivery events caused a fun incident last spring. Retries back off exponentially, so don't panic if events arrive late. The handler lives in the tracking service; docs for the payload shape are in the wiki. To verify incoming payloads locally, use the signing key below.

deploy key for kajof-fajop: bky6_gDHw9Q

## Local Setup — Watchdog

The Larkstone kiosk watchdog restarts the shell app when the heartbeat stalls. Clone the repo, install deps with `make bootstrap`, and run `watchdogd --dev`. Logs land in `./var/log`. The watchdog records restart events in a small Postgres table; run `make migrate` before first launch. Use the seeded dev database, not production. Heartbeat interval defaults to 5s; override in `watchdog.toml`. For the event store, connect with the following connection string.

database URL for tajog-bajeg: mysql://soreth_svc:OzsCjhu@db-6997.nelvrostack.internal:5432/kelax